Why Python Is Still the Most Popular Programming Language to Learn Blog Banner

Why Python Is Still the Most Popular Programming Language to Learn

Technology evolves every year. New technologies and frameworks emerge. Older ones either transform or get dethroned. Shifts, particularly in recent years, prove this. However, exceptions exist. One such exception that defies the typical lifecycle of each technology is the 35-year-old programming language Python. But why is it still the most popular programming language? Why is a Python course in Pune the launchpad to IT careers? Here is a blog that breaks down the reasons.

Human-First Syntax

Python has a syntax that closely resembles natural language. Hence, it is remarkably easy to understand even for someone with no prior programming experience. For example, for a beginner, writing a Good Morning World program in Python is a single line. But writing the same thing in Java or C++ requires multiple boilerplate code lines. Therefore, Python offers a low barrier to entry and a softer learning curve, enabling developers to focus on solving problems rather than mastering intricate syntax.

Unparalleled Library Ecosystem

Python boasts an unrivaled ecosystem of libraries such as TensorFlow, Pandas, NumPy, and Scikit-learn that simplify tasks such as ML, data manipulation, and statistics analysis. A mature, developed ecosystem like this saves the developer’s efforts in reinventing the wheel every time they build an application. Developers can leverage libraries to build robust apps, saving time and effort, and increasing productivity.

Versatility Across Multiple Domains

Python is not anchored to a particular single use case. It is a general-purpose powerhouse. Therefore, you can use it in web development just as much as in ML, data analysis, game development, automation, and cybersecurity. Such levels of domain versatility make the language a truly comprehensive solution. 

Now, how does this benefit you as a learner exploring diverse career paths? You benefit from the flexibility Python offers. Therefore, you can begin with basic scripting and then transition into advanced domains without needing to switch languages.

Extensive Community Support

Python has developed an active user community in its nearly three-and-a-half-decade journey. Therefore, once you become a Python user and join a Python course in Pune, you will have access to abundant resources, tutorials, forums, and documentation. Usually, when you get stuck on a problem, chances are someone has already faced the problem and developed a solution for it. 

Such an active user community support makes Python a popular language to learn and a preferred language for millions of developers.

Enterprise-Level Adoption

It isn’t just developers who prefer Python, but companies as well. Some global ones include Uber, Netflix, Google, Spotify, and Instagram, rely on Python to cater to various parts of their infrastructure. While defining the reliability of Python in the corporate world, such enterprise-level adoption also ensures long-term job security and a steady demand for skilled Python developers.

High Demand in the Job Market

Learning Python unlocks a broad spectrum of job opportunities across various domains. Today, every company uses data analysis, data science, and AI/ ML applications to optimize its business strategies and processes. Python is used in most of them. Therefore, such companies, particularly those engaged in developing applications for diverse business domains, actively seek qualified Python developers. 

Besides, roles that require data analysis, backend development, and automation engineering list Python as a required skill. Hence, enrolling in a Python course in Pune and earning a valuable certification from a reputable institute can help you stand out. 

Scalability and Flexibility

Python is also popular for its extensive flexibility and scalability. Therefore, from a simple script that renames files to a gigantic enterprise cloud-based architecture, Python scales seamlessly and reliably. With such flexibility, you can venture into different programming territories, such as object-oriented, procedural, or functional programming, based on the project needs of your employer.

Enrolling in a Python Course in Pune: Why Should Tech Aspirants Learn Python?

With everything Python offers, it isn’t just a programming language but a career enabler. Here’s why learning Python is a must for every job seeker in the tech domain.

  • Data Scientist: Python enables collecting, cleaning, analyzing, and visualizing data. Its libraries simplify extracting meaningful insights from complex datasets.
  • AI ML Developer: The language has frameworks and tools that help build systems, including recommendation engines to image recognition models.
  • Software Developer: Frameworks such as Django and Flask help developers rapidly develop scalable web applications.
  • Beginners and Career Switchers: With a softer learning curve and high demand, Python is a smooth entry point for freshers and job switchers.

Final Words!

Over time, many programming languages have emerged. Yet, Python stays strong and relevant. As it evolves, it becomes richer, more useful, and more relevant, helping shape emerging technologies such as AI. Therefore, enrolling in a Python course in Pune isn’t just an academic move but a strategic career decision. But the institute you choose also matters. So, Jason School, a reputable Python training institute with years of experience, a comprehensive curriculum, practical exposure, experienced faculty members, and placement assistance, is here to help. Call us at +91 79720 78620 to learn more about our courses, upcoming batches, and Python course fees in Pune.

Get Free Career Counseling

One of our advisor will call you in less than 45 minutes*

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E

DOWNLOAD BROCHURE